diff --git a/libs/core/src/functions/fetch-devfiles/devfiles.json b/libs/core/src/functions/fetch-devfiles/devfiles.json index 192c714c..148f1073 100644 --- a/libs/core/src/functions/fetch-devfiles/devfiles.json +++ b/libs/core/src/functions/fetch-devfiles/devfiles.json @@ -67,6 +67,40 @@ } ] }, + { + "name": "dotnet80", + "displayName": ".NET 8.0", + "description": "Stack with .NET 8.0", + "type": "stack", + "tags": [ + "dotnet" + ], + "icon": "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AcgAAAHICAMAAAD9f4rYAAAAS1BMVEVRK9RRK9T///+olenTyvTp5fpnRdl8YN++r+708v1cONedh+e+ru5nRtl9YN6HbeKyouzJvfKSeuSzou2+r+9yU9ze1/dcONbe2PcNfWisAAAAAXRSTlP+GuMHfQAAB79JREFUeNrs0QENAAAMw6Ddv+n7aMACOwomskFkhMgIkREiI0RGiIwQGSEyQmSEyAiRESIjREaIjBAZITJCZITICJERIiNERoiMEBkhMkJkhMgIkREiI0RGiIwQGSEyQmSEyAiRESIjREaIjBAZITJCZITICJERIiNERoiMEBkhMkJkhMgIkREiI0RGiIwQGSEyQmSEyAiRESIjREaIjBAZITJCZITICJERIiNERoiMEBkhMkJkhMgIkREiI0RGiIwQGSEyQmSEyAiRESIjREaIjBAZITJCZITICJERIiNERoiMEBkhMkJkhMgIkREiI0RGiIwQGSEyQmSEyAiRESIjREaIjBAZITJCZITICJERIiNERoiMEBkhMkJkhMgIkREiI0RGiIwQGSEyQmSEyAiRESKfnTvMTRyGoiisF5K2SYZhKKX7X+pEeuov7Ngxorp+OmcH9KssLnISJCCDBGSQgAwSkEECMkhABgnIIAEZJCCDBGSQgAwSkEECMkhABgnIIAEZJCCDBGSQgAwSkEECMkhABgnIIAEZJCCDBGSQgAwSkEECMkhABgnIIAEZJCCDBGSQgAwSkEECMki/DzkNqUZr7H146M0ynYZnmgof4cn+2BPpQA6rFQMymxDk/GalgMwmBDlcrRSQ2ZQgh79WCMhsUpDTYvsBmU0Kcvhn+wGZTQuydLgCmU0MsjAmgcwmBlkYk0BmU4PcH5NAZlOD3D9cgcwmBzlcLB+Q2fQg98YkkNn0IPfGJJDZBCF3xiSQ2RQhvy3XKyDnsboP++k6FpoT/wZjodWeSBEyPyZfATnaKxqHh072yiQhj4xJID1JyCN/XCA9TcgDYxJITxRyXqwyID1RyPoxCaSnClk9JoH0NCDH9jEJpKcBeR+aPzeQngbk5do8JoH0NCA/35vHJJCeBuRqY0Ly0yoC0tOAPNm5dUwC6alA2q1xTALpaUBuYsvUNiaB9DQgP8w9Gq59AOnpQNq1aUwC6QlBnueWMQmkJwRpa8uYBNJTgrSx4doHkJ4UZMuYBNKTgkzeVvyy3YD0tCAbxiSQnhZkw5gE0hODtNvRMQmkpwa5zEOtiwekpwZpl4NjEkhPDvLomATS04M8z4fGJJCeHqSth95uBqQnCGnjkTEJpKcIeT8yJoH0FCEPjUkgPUnI5C91d0v2a08sf1p9QJp34JprM2S5dgcgf/qqHpNAeqKQS/W1DyA9Ucj6MQmkpwpZPSaB9GQhz3PdmATSk4W0U90zBEB6upD2XXW4AukJQ9aNSSA9YUi71YxJID1lyGWqGJNAesqQVYcrkJ40pF3LbzcD0tOGXMpjEkhPG9LW4pgE0hOHLP9S9zTkPNW1Wn1APnSeC28344aApw5pp8KYBNKTh7TCmATS04csjEkgPX1Iu+2OSSC9DiCXae8ZAiC9DiDtsjcmgfR6gNwdk0B6XUDujUkgvS4gbc3/ZAak1wekjdkxCaTXCeQ9OyaB9DqBtFPuVdlAer1AZsckkF4vkPaeGZNAet1A2i09JoH0+oHMXvu4A7nVD6RdMmPyDcitjiDTYxJIryfI85xkWIDc6gnS1vS1DyC3uoK0MTkmZyDN+oJMj8kJSLO+INNjcgTSrDPIZUpIfAFp1hlk8nDlaN3qDTL1KiW+tW51B7nMQKbqDtJWIP+zdwerDcNQEEUZWbIqG9XESev8/5d2EQol7wXcZBSwmLv3Zg54oYXkdTxIREE6HRCyFkHa2JDbfEohlHj5xINehsQgSBsXchtK+C2tcHsdEt+CNFEhx7Tj0XICZBakiQk53gvFCTYCJM5EyOv4nzbs6diQowW6wMaAnBIBsuGVEMeG3Hl9NQMSWZAmFmQO+x7WpUDiJMhbfEh/2hkmCmQtgkQbyOB2gokCiVmQQAvIHNwSTBxIREE2gVyCH0wkyCrIJpBrMLWFxCDIVr/W90JOSZANIMfgdoWJBYksSD6kx+Oft/IgcRZkA0h/owoTD3IqgqRD+qteYCJCYhEkHdJdNVWYmJCIguRD2pXKF2xUyFoESYc0MyXXkQqJWZANILH+NYoVfvNw34KnmwenCQ/Kw4vlvUt4n7aKDwms8aZYPjLU2+JDAlte1jxCvbUbpOohQXaSIDtJkJ0kyE4SZCcJspME2UmC/GGPDmQAAAAABvlb36M9hRBHIo5EHIk4EnEk4kjEkYgjEUcijkQciTgScSTiSMSRiCMRRyKORByJOBJxJOJIxJGIIxFHIo5EHIk4EnEk4kjEkYgjEUciYo8OZAAAAAAG+Vvf4yuFRE6InBA5IXJC5ITICZETIidEToicEDkhckLkhMgJkRMiJ0ROiJwQOSFyQuSEyAmREyInRE6InBA5IXJC5ITICZETIidEToicEDkhckLkhMgJkRMiJ0ROiJwQOSFyQuSEyAmREyInRE6InBA5IXJC5ITICZETIidEToicEDkhckLkhMgJkRMiJ0ROiJwQWXt0QAMAAIAwyP6p7cFOBRBFIopEFIkoElEkokhEkYgiEUUiikQUiSgSUSSiSESRiCIRRSKKRBSJKBJRJKJIRJGIIhFFIopEFIkoElEkokhEkYgiEUUiikQUiSgSUSSiSESRiCIRRSKKRBSJKBJRJKJIRJGIIhFFIopEFIkoElEkokjEgjh2WnxgwCuWdQAAAABJRU5ErkJggg==", + "projectType": "dotnet", + "language": "dotnet", + "versions": [ + { + "version": "1.0.0", + "schemaVersion": "2.1.0", + "default": true, + "description": "Stack with .NET 8.0", + "tags": [ + "dotnet" + ], + "icon": "https://github.com/dotnet/brand/raw/main/logo/dotnet-logo.png", + "links": { + "self": "devfile-catalog/dotnet80:1.0.0" + }, + "resources": [ + "archive.tar", + "devfile.yaml" + ], + "starterProjects": [ + "s2i-example" + ] + } + ] + }, { "name": "dotnetcore31", "displayName": ".NET Core 3.1", @@ -1067,4 +1101,4 @@ }, "provider": "Red Hat" } -] \ No newline at end of file +] diff --git a/libs/docs/src/docs/no-version/creating-a-devfile-stack.md b/libs/docs/src/docs/no-version/creating-a-devfile-stack.md index b44d6d06..d2f74f79 100644 --- a/libs/docs/src/docs/no-version/creating-a-devfile-stack.md +++ b/libs/docs/src/docs/no-version/creating-a-devfile-stack.md @@ -34,7 +34,7 @@ There you can include yourself as a reviewer (For more information check the [ow metadata: name: tutorial-stack displayName: Tutorial Stack - description: Test stack based on .Net 6.0 + description: Test stack based on .Net 8.0 icon: https://github.com/dotnet/brand/raw/main/logo/dotnet-logo.png tags: - .NET @@ -50,7 +50,7 @@ There you can include yourself as a reviewer (For more information check the [ow git: checkoutFrom: remote: origin - revision: dotnet-6.0 + revision: dotnet-8.0 remotes: origin: https://github.com/redhat-developer/s2i-dotnetcore-ex subDir: app @@ -61,7 +61,7 @@ There you can include yourself as a reviewer (For more information check the [ow components: - name: dotnet container: - image: registry.access.redhat.com/ubi8/dotnet-60:6.0 + image: registry.access.redhat.com/ubi8/dotnet-80:8.0-9 args: ["tail", "-f", "/dev/null"] mountSources: true env: @@ -74,7 +74,7 @@ There you can include yourself as a reviewer (For more information check the [ow - name: ASPNETCORE_URLS value: http://*:8080 endpoints: - - name: http-dotnet60 + - name: http-dotnet80 targetPort: 8080 ``` @@ -105,7 +105,7 @@ There you can include yourself as a reviewer (For more information check the [ow metadata: name: tutorial-stack displayName: Tutorial Stack - description: Test stack based on .Net 6.0 + description: Test stack based on .Net 8.0 icon: https://github.com/dotnet/brand/raw/main/logo/dotnet-logo.png tags: - .NET @@ -117,14 +117,14 @@ There you can include yourself as a reviewer (For more information check the [ow git: checkoutFrom: remote: origin - revision: dotnet-6.0 + revision: dotnet-8.0 remotes: origin: https://github.com/redhat-developer/s2i-dotnetcore-ex subDir: app components: - name: dotnet container: - image: registry.access.redhat.com/ubi8/dotnet-60:6.0 + image: registry.access.redhat.com/ubi8/dotnet-80:8.0-9 args: ["tail", "-f", "/dev/null"] mountSources: true env: @@ -137,7 +137,7 @@ There you can include yourself as a reviewer (For more information check the [ow - name: ASPNETCORE_URLS value: http://*:8080 endpoints: - - name: http-dotnet60 + - name: http-dotnet80 targetPort: 8080 commands: - id: build @@ -162,7 +162,7 @@ There you can include yourself as a reviewer (For more information check the [ow ```yaml {% filename="stack.yaml" %} name: tutorial-stack displayName: Tutorial Stack - description: Test stack based on .Net 6.0 + description: Test stack based on .Net 8.0 icon: https://github.com/dotnet/brand/raw/main/logo/dotnet-logo.png versions: - version: 2.2.0